Subdividing Bezier curves
Click to define the four control points. Then click the `Divide' button and select the yellow dot where you wish to subdivide the curve. Repeat this procedure to subdivide the curve as many times as you like. Note how the control points become a good polyline approximation to the curve after only a few subdivisions. Note also how the curve is unchanged as you subdivide, although the larger number of control points offers greater freedom for fine-tuning. Try to fine-tune the curve by clicking and dragging control points, and note the difficulty in maintaining a continuous first derivative.
